Let's look at why the stock is a good buy while it is still trading at under $35. Investors interested in Enterprise are often first attracted to the company for its robust distribution and forward yield, which currently sits at 6.4%. However, Enterprise is more than just a high-yielding stock, it is a model of consistency. The master limited partnership (MLP) has been able to increase its distribution for 26 straight years. It has been able to do this through various different energy markets and economic conditions. This speaks both to the company's strong business model and management's conservative approach. Historically, over 80% of the company's business is fee-based and 90% of its contracts have inflation escalation provisions. Fee-based means that these businesses collect set fees, which aren't impacted by energy prices or commodity spreads. It also tries to add take-or-pay provisions to its contracts, which means it gets paid whether or not a customer uses its pipelines
